Popular Welder’s Qualifications

Although the American Welding Society’s standard Certified Welder certificate helps make you eligible for almost all job opportunities, certain industries demand a certain certificate. Examples of the most-well-known of them appear below.

  • American Petroleum Institute Certification for welders that work on pipelines in the oil and gas field
  • American Society of Mechanical Engineers Certification for welders that work with boiler and pressure containers
  • CWI and SCWI Certification for inspectors and senior inspectors
  • CW Certification to become a Certified Welder

The following table displays wage and jobs forecasts for professional welders in the State of Ohio through 2022.

Ohio Employment
2012 2022 Change Annual Job Openings
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ers 13,760 14,370 4% 400
Ohio Annual Salary
Low Median High
Welders,
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ers
$24,800 $35,300 $50,800

Source: O*Net Online

The Basics of Welding Specialist Classes

Although there isn’t a strategy guide teaching you how to pick the right certified welding schools, there are certain items to consider. Selecting welding programs may perhaps appear simple, but you must make sure that that you’re choosing the right kind of training. We cannot stress enough the significance of the program or school you select being certified and approved by the AWS. Although not as vital as accreditation, you might want to look at a few of the following areas as well:

  • Try to find classes that fulfill AWS SENSE standards
  • Make sure the institution trains on machinery that suits present trade requirements
  • See if the program offers financial aid
  • Confirm the school’s program provides classes in GTAW, SMAW, pipe welding and GMAW
